    Despite the 22 degree weather I went out to the lake about 10 miles from home to try some flight shots on gulls ... it was overcast gray skies so the background is boring but I got some nice images.


    1DMKIII


    300mm 2.8L + 1.4TC II


    Hand Held


    Manual mode


    Evaluative metering


    ISO 1600


    1/1600


    f/6.3


    580 EXII + Better Beamer ETTL mode

    Quote Originally Posted by JJphoto
    I was wondering those bluish color of the ice was from PP or it was like that in real world?
    JJ,the ice really was blue. I increased the contrast slightly but didn't mess with the white balance or saturation at all.

    The ice had broken offa nearby glacier, and glacier ice usually has a blue or green tint. Try this link for an explanation: http://epod.usra.edu/blog/2010/12/blue-glacier-ice.html

    Here's another example that shows the difference in colour between the glacier ice and the snow in the background. To avoid going too far off topic, I made sure to choose an example with some more kittiwakes.


    5D Mark II, EF24-105mm f/4L IS USM @ 105mm, f/8, 1/320s, ISO 100
